Output 3de1951fa4a9ef552295a652e5a3684361741237fc084a91c24d26859e13997a:0

value
34030000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ad587c801173eee89be1bbb76cdc6cf7676d1fb OP_EQUALVERIFY OP_CHECKSIG
address
19HHccmeeUnxGMYm1VZRN7turwvz7wHoa7
transaction
3de1951fa4a9ef552295a652e5a3684361741237fc084a91c24d26859e13997a
spent
true